House prices in Grange-Over-Sands in 2025

Last year, we saw 169 properties sold in the area, with an average house price of £310,230. This represents a decrease of -26.2% in the volume of transactions year on year. Meanwhile the average selling price saw a decrease of -6.13% in the same period. The average value add score for the area is 63.

Where does this data come from?

The property price data for England and Wales that you see on our website is sourced primarily from HM Land Registry's Price Paid Data. This dataset is the one source of truth for most of the country’s residential property transactions. Where available, we’ve enhanced this with information gathered from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) data and then further added to it with records from various trusted additional sources. This material was last updated on October 7, 2024.

Some of the figures you see above, such as the Value Potential score are constructed using our own proprietary algorithmic modelling. They are most decidedly estimates, and may be off the mark. Please use this information cautiously, and as a guide only. If in doubt, and certainly before putting in an offer anywhere, please speak with your local estate agent to get a better understanding of the property’s valuation.

Grange-Over-Sands area guide

Stunning coastal views

Grange-Over-Sands is known for its breathtaking views of Morecambe Bay, providing scenic walks along the promenade and beautiful sunsets.

Victorian architecture

The town features charming Victorian buildings and well-maintained gardens, reflecting its history as a popular seaside resort during the Victorian era.

Access to the Lake District

Located on the edge of the Lake District, Grange-Over-Sands serves as a gateway for outdoor enthusiasts looking to explore the national park's stunning landscapes.

Quiet lifestyle

The tranquil environment may not appeal to individuals seeking a more vibrant or bustling social scene.

Infrequent public transport

Public transport options can be sparse, making it challenging for those without a car to access nearby towns or attractions.

Limited shopping facilities

The range of shops and amenities in Grange-Over-Sands may be limited compared to larger towns, which could affect convenience for residents.
